Function Keys

 

 

 

F1

Displays the Office Assistant or (Help > Microsoft Excel Help)

F2

Edits the active cell, putting the cursor at the end*

F3

Displays the (Insert > Name > Paste) dialog box

F4

Repeats the last worksheet action (Edit > Repeat)

F5

Displays the (Edit > GoTo) dialog box

F6

Moves to the next pane in a workbook (if the window is split)

F7

Displays the (Tools > Spelling) dialog box

F8

Toggles whether to extend a selection with the arrow keys

F9

Calculates All the worksheets in All the open workbooks

F10

Toggles the activation of the Menu Bar

F11

Displays the (Insert > Chart) dialog box that creates a chart (on a chart sheet) using the highlighted range

F12

Displays the (File > Save As) dialog box

 

 

 

Note: *This is only available with (Tools > Options, Edit tab, Edit directly in cell).

Entering Data

 

 

 

Enter

Enters the contents of the active cell and moves to the cell below (by default)

Shift + Enter

Enters the contents of the active cell and moves to the cell above (by default)

Tab

Enters the contents of the active cell and moves one cell to the right

Shift + Tab

Enters the contents of the active cell and moves one cell to the left

Alt + =

Enters the SUM() function (AutoSum) to sum the adjacent block of cells

Alt + 0128

Enters the euro symbol (€) (using Number keypad)

Alt + 0162

Enters the cent symbol (¢) (using Number keypad)

Alt + 0163

Enters the pound sign symbol (£) (using Number keypad)

Alt + 0165

Enters the yen symbol (¥) (using Number keypad)

Alt + Enter

Enters a new line (or carriage return) into a cell

Ctrl + '

Enters the formula from the cell directly above into the active cell

Ctrl + Shift + 2

Enters the value from the cell directly above into the active cell

Ctrl + ;

Enters the current date into the active cell

Ctrl + Enter

Enters the contents of the active cell to the selected region

Ctrl + Shift + ;

Enters the current time into the active cell

Ctrl + Shift + Enter

Enters the formula as an Array Formula

Shift + Insert

Enters the data from the clipboard

Alt + Down Arrow

Displays the Pick From List drop-down list

Esc

Cancels the cell entry and restores the original contents

Selecting Data

 

 

 

Ctrl + \

Selects the cells in a selected row that do not match the value in the active cell

Ctrl + Shift + \

Selects the cells in a selected column that do not match the value in the active cell

Ctrl + /

Selects the array containing the active cell ??

Alt + ;

Selects the visible cells in the current selection

Ctrl + Enter

Selects the first object / chart ??

Ctrl + Shift + (8 or *)

Selects the current region (surrounded by blank rows and columns)

Ctrl + *

Selects the current region (using the * on the number keyboard)

Ctrl + [

Selects all the cells that are directly referred to by the formula in the active cell (precedents)

Ctrl + Shift + [

Selects all the cells that are directly (or indirectly) referred to by the formula in the active cell

Ctrl + ]

Selects all the cells that directly refer to the active cell (dependents)

Ctrl + Shift + ]

Selects all the cells that directly (or indirectly) refer to the active cell

Ctrl + Shift + Page Down

Selects the active worksheet and the one after it

Ctrl + Shift + Page Up

Selects the active worksheet and the one before it

Ctrl + Shift + Spacebar

Selects all the objects on the worksheet when an object is selected or selects the whole worksheet

Ctrl + Backspace

Selects the current active cell (scrolling if necessary)

Ctrl + Spacebar

Selects the current column

Shift + Arrow keys

Selects the active cell and the cell in the given direction

Shift + Backspace

Selects the active cell when multiple cells are selected

Shift + Spacebar

Selects the current row

Formatting Data

 

 

 

Alt + '

Displays the (Format > Style) dialog box

Ctrl + Shift + ( ' or ¬)

Applies the Time format "hh:mm" to the selection

Ctrl + Shift + (1 or !)

Applies the Comma separated format "#,##0.00" to the selection

Ctrl + Shift + (4 or $)

Applies the Currency format "£#,##0.00" to the selection

Ctrl + Shift + (5 or %)

Applies the Percentage format "0%" to the selection

Ctrl + Shift + (6 or ^)

Applies the Exponential format "#,##E+02" to the selection

Ctrl + Shift + (# or ~)

Applies the General format to the selection

Ctrl + (# or ~)

Applies the Custom Date format "dd-mmm-yy" to the selection

Ctrl + Shift + (7 or &)

Applies the outline border to the selection

Ctrl + Shift + (- or _ )

Removes all the borders from the selection

 

 

 

Maneuvering

 

 

 

Arrow Keys

Moves to the next cell in that direction

Ctrl + Tab

Moves to the next open workbook or window

Alt + Tab

Moves to the next application open on your computer

Alt + Shift + Tab

Moves to the previous application open on your computer

Enter

Moves to the cell directly below

Tab

Moves to the next cell on the right (or unprotected cell)

Home

Moves to the first column in the current row

End, Arrow Keys

Moves to the next non empty cell in that direction

End, Enter

Moves to the last cell in the current row that is not blank

End + Home

Moves to the last used cell on the active worksheet*

End, Home

Moves to the last used cell on the active worksheet*

Page Down

Moves to the next screen of rows down

Page Up

Moves to the previous screen of rows up

Shift + Enter

Moves to the cell directly above (opposite direction to Enter)

Shift + Tab

Moves to the cell directly to the left (opposite direction to Tab)

Alt + Page Down

Moves you one screen of columns to the right

Alt + Page Up

Moves you one screen of columns to the left

Ctrl + Home

Moves to cell "A1" on the active sheet

Ctrl + End

Moves to the last used cell on the active worksheet*

Ctrl + Up Arrow

Moves to the first row in the current region

Ctrl + Down Arrow

Moves to the last row in the current region

Ctrl + Left Arrow

Moves to the first column in the current region

Ctrl + Right Arrow

Moves to the last column in the current region

Ctrl + Page Up

Moves to the previous worksheet in the workbook

Ctrl + Page Down

Moves to the next worksheet in the workbook

Ctrl + Shift + Tab

Moves to the previous open workbook or window

Ctrl + Backspace

Moves to the display the active cell

Scroll Lock + Arrow Keys

Moves the workbook or window one cell the corresponding direction

Scroll Lock + End

Moves to the last cell in the current window

Scroll Lock + Home

Moves to the first cell in the current window

Scroll Lock + Page Down

Moves you down one screen (current selection unchanged)

Scroll Lock + Page Up

Moves you up one screen (current selection unchanged)

 

 

 

Note: *This is only updated when the workbook is closed.

 

 

 

Maneuvering (within a selection)

 

 

 

Enter

Moves from top to bottom within a selection

Tab

Moves from left to right within a selection

Ctrl + .

Moves clockwise to the next corner within a selection

Shift + Tab

Moves from right to left within a selection (opposite direction to Tab)

Alt + Ctrl + Left Arrow

Moves to the left between non adjacent cells in a selection

Alt + Ctrl + Right Arrow

Moves to the right between non adjacent cells in a selection
